Hello!  You may or may not already know that I have a minor obsession with seeing how high I can climb!  For the past year I have been planning a trip, for entirely selfish reasons, to Argentina, to see if I can reach the top of Aconcagua  http://www.keadventure.com/trip/3363/aconcagua.html  At 6962m/22,835ft, Aconcagua is the world’s highest peak outside of Asia.  It is generally considered a trek rather than a technical climb, but its difficulty lies in its altitude and vicious weather system.

Clair’s choice of charity is Gloucestershire Animal Welfare Association and Cheltenham Animal Shelter, charity no. 1081019 - http://www.gawa.org.uk/ .  Like many other charities that receive no government support, Cheltenham Animal Shelter has suffered during the recession, and the health and welfare of many animals is reliant upon our good will.


A £5 donation provides flea and worm treatment for one dog or cat.  £10 provides vaccinations for one dog or cat, and £15 feeds one dog or cat for a month.

The shelter also has an excellent education programme.  A unique part of the shelter's education portfolio is the HALT Project (Humans and Animals Learning Together), an animal assisted therapy programme delivered five times a year for 'at risk' youth in Gloucestershire.  Read more about it at:     http://www.gawa.org.uk/education.
